Amid the rapid development of generative neural networks and the widespread proliferation of deepfakes, the issue of digital trust has become one of the key priorities for tech giants. In the fifth beta version of the operating system iOS 27, which is currently under active development, researchers discovered code for a new feature named Apple Reference Image. This technology aims to become a powerful tool in the fight against visual content falsification, allowing users to verify the authenticity of photos taken on an iPhone.

How the authenticity verification mechanism works

The essence of the new function lies in the automatic recording of metadata regarding the origin of the shot directly at the moment of its creation. According to data obtained from 9to5Mac, the system will embed a digital signature that guarantees the image was created by the device's camera and has not undergone generative processing by artificial intelligence. This allows users to subsequently prove the authenticity of the material, which is critically important in an era where visual evidence no longer guarantees the truth.

It is important to note that the function will not run in the background for all shots. Developers have provided a special mode in the camera settings that the user will have to activate manually by selecting the Reference option. This means that metadata for identification will be embedded only in those photos taken using this specific mode. Existing images in the user's gallery will not be retroactively marked.

Competition with the C2PA standard

The principle of operation of Apple Reference Image largely resembles the C2PA (Coalition for Content Provenance and Authenticity) standard, which industry giants such as Canon, Nikon, Sony, Fujifilm, and Leica have already begun to implement. Furthermore, support for this technology has already appeared in Google Pixel 10 smartphones. However, Apple, traditionally avoiding the use of third-party standards in its ecosystems, has decided to go its own way by creating its own solution.

Experts believe that Apple's proprietary development could become an alternative to the C2PA standard, which, despite widespread support, is not always considered absolutely reliable. Its own system for marking original materials created by humans will allow Apple to simplify the content verification process within its ecosystem, ensuring a higher level of trust in materials created on the company's devices.

Contradictory data

At present, there are discrepancies in information regarding the availability and implementation timeline of the function. On the one hand, the function's code has already been found in iOS 27 beta versions, confirming the fact of development. On the other hand, sources indicate that the function is currently unavailable even for testers in current builds. It remains unclear whether this function will be available immediately after the release of the final version of iOS 27 or will require an additional update. Furthermore, it is currently unclear exactly how this function will interact with social networks and messengers, which often compress images and remove metadata upon upload.

Significance in the fight against fakes

Previously, Instagram head Adam Mosseri noted that verifying the origin of such publications might be easier than detecting and marking increasingly sophisticated and high-quality content generated by artificial intelligence. The implementation of Apple Reference Image could become a turning point in this fight, shifting the focus from detecting fakes to guaranteeing authenticity.
